Completely renovated mid century modern home nestled in a private cul-de-sac on the little sugar bike trail .15 miles from Tanyard falls. Every inch of this home has been made new. Enjoy walks to the waterfalls with on property trail access, bike storage and wash station, and views from the deck of this peaceful property.
